mission · from form 990

AN EDUCATIONAL ORGANIZATION DEDICATED TO EDUCATING WOMAN AND GIRLS AND PROVIDING TOOLS THAT HELP THEM TO EMBRACE AND USE THEIR GENDER ATTRIBUTES FOR POSITIVE RESULTS IN ALL OF THEIR INTERACTIONS. THE ORGANIZATION'S TRAININGS ARE OPEN TO WOMEN AND GIRLS ACROSS ALL SOCIO-ECONOMIC AND ETHNIC BACKGROUNDS. THE TRAINING HELPS WOMEN STEP INTO LEADERSHIP ROLES IN THEIR FAMILIES, COMMUNITIES, PROFESSIONAL AND ACADEMIC WORLDS WHILE ACKNOWLEDGING AND EMBRACING THEIR GENDER DIFFERENCES. THIS IS IN AN EFFORT TO CREATE A COMMUNITY THAT ACKNOWLEDGES THE NEED FOR WOMEN AND GIRLS TO LEARN AND SUPPORT EACH OTHER IN ACHIEVING THEIR DREAMS AS THEY EMBRACE THE POSITIVE INHERENT ATTRIBUTES THAT ARE FEMALE.

profile · synthesized from sources

HerWisdom Inc is an educational nonprofit that empowers women and girls to embrace their gender-specific attributes as a foundation for authentic leadership. The organization offers programs that integrate cyclical awareness, emotional intelligence, and indigenous wisdom to cultivate personal and community transformation. Its trainings are open to women and girls across socioeconomic, ethnic, and cultural backgrounds, with a focus on holistic, intergenerational development.

named programs · 2 · from sources

What they call their work

Observing Our Cycles Course
8-week virtual course exploring the menstrual cycle as a gateway to women's wisdom, including weekly video lessons, guided movement, and live support sessions
Women's Leadership Training
Programs that help women develop authentic leadership grounded in emotional intelligence, compassion, and gender-specific strengths, rather than emulating male leadership models
